Ingrid recruits Shopify’s Fraser Trivett as Chief Revenue Officer

Delivery and returns platform Ingrid has appointed former Shopify executive Fraser Trivett as its new Chief Revenue Officer. Trivett, who previously served as Head of Revenue for Northern Europe at Shopify, joins the company as it scales its efforts to transform logistics from a passive cost center into a proactive customer experience driver.

Trivett’s arrival coincides with a strategic push by Ingrid to modernize how brands manage their delivery infrastructure. The platform recently enabled luxury retailer Osprey London to overhaul its fragmented legacy systems, replacing them with a unified interface that supports ship-from-store, nominated-day delivery, and integrated returns. According to Ben Jones, Head of E-commerce & Technology at Osprey London, the integration has shifted delivery from a background operational expense to a primary revenue and loyalty tool.

By centralizing these functions, Ingrid aims to provide merchants with the agility to adapt to shifting consumer demands. Piotr Zaleski, CPTO and Co-Founder of Ingrid, noted that the company’s focus remains on helping brands treat logistics as a core component of customer retention. Moving forward, Osprey London intends to leverage this infrastructure to integrate delivery perks directly into its upcoming loyalty program, offering members benefits such as extended returns windows and free fulfillment options.
